The role
About the Role
The Youth Education Service is working with an Alternative Provision school in Liverpool, supporting primary-aged pupils with SEN, SEMH needs, Autism, ADHD, and additional learning difficulties.
We are looking for a Primary SEN Teacher to start in September.
This is a 10-12 week temp-to-perm role, with the successful teacher paid from their current scale point from day one, plus SEN 1 allowance.
You will be teaching primary-aged pupils in a structured and supportive Alternative Provision setting, delivering engaging lessons that are adapted to individual needs.
This role would suit a Primary Teacher with SEN experience, strong behaviour management, or a genuine interest in moving into Alternative Provision.
Key Responsibilities
* Plan and deliver engaging primary lessons.
* Adapt teaching to meet individual pupil needs.
* Support pupils with SEN, SEMH, Autism, ADHD, and additional learning difficulties.
* Create a calm, structured, and nurturing classroom environment.
* Use positive behaviour management strategies to support pupil engagement.
* Work closely with teaching assistants, pastoral staff, and senior leaders.
* Support pupils' academic, social, and emotional development.
* Maintain safeguarding and professional standards at all times.
What We're Looking For
* Qualified Teacher Status or relevant teaching qualification.
* Primary teaching experience.
* SEN, SEMH, or Alternative Provision experience is desirable.
* Calm, resilient, and nurturing approach.
* Strong behaviour management skills.
* Ability to build positive relationships with pupils.
* Good communication and teamwork skills.
* Commitment to safeguarding children and young people.
Pay & Benefits
* Paid from current scale point from day one.
* SEN 1 allowance included.
* Weekly pay.
* September start.
* 10-12 week temp-to-perm opportunity.
* Full-time role.
* Ongoing CPD and training opportunities.
* Dedicated & Direct support from the Directors at YES
Safeguarding
The Youth Education Service is committed to safeguarding children and young people.
All applicants will be subject to enhanced DBS, reference, and compliance checks.
An enhanced DBS on the Update Service is desirable, but not essential, as support can be provided with the application process.
